TestServer Class
Definition
An IServer implementation for executing tests.
public ref class TestServer : IDisposable, Microsoft::AspNetCore::Hosting::Server::IServer
public class TestServer : IDisposable, Microsoft.AspNetCore.Hosting.Server.IServer
type TestServer = class
interface IServer
interface IDisposable
Public Class TestServer
Implements IDisposable, IServer

Constructors
TestServer(IServiceProvider) |
For use with IHostBuilder. |
TestServer(IServiceProvider, IFeatureCollection) |
For use with IHostBuilder. |
TestServer(IWebHostBuilder) |
For use with IWebHostBuilder. |
TestServer(IWebHostBuilder, IFeatureCollection) |
For use with IWebHostBuilder. |
Properties
AllowSynchronousIO |
Gets or sets a value that controls whether synchronous IO is allowed for the Request and Response. The default value is |
BaseAddress |
Gets or sets the base address associated with the HttpClient returned by the test server. Defaults to http://localhost/. |
Features |
Gets the collection of server features associated with the test server. |
Host |
Gets the IWebHost instance associated with the test server. |
PreserveExecutionContext |
Gets or sets a value that controls if ExecutionContext and AsyncLocal<T> values are preserved from the client to the server. The default value is |
Services |
Gets the service provider associated with the test server. |
Methods
CreateClient() |
Creates a HttpClient for processing HTTP requests/responses with the test server. |
CreateHandler() |
Creates a custom HttpMessageHandler for processing HTTP requests/responses with the test server. |
CreateRequest(String) |
Begins constructing a request message for submission. |
CreateWebSocketClient() |
Creates a WebSocketClient for interacting with the test server. |
Dispose() |
Dispoes the IWebHost object associated with the test server. |
SendAsync(Action<HttpContext>, CancellationToken) |
Creates, configures, sends, and returns a HttpContext. This completes as soon as the response is started. |
